- The distance between Grand Coteau, La, Usa and Lusaka Int., Zambia is approximately 13,759 km or 8,550 mi.
- To reach Grand Coteau, La in this distance one would set out from Lusaka Int. bearing 296.1°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Grand Coteau, La bearing 268.9° or W .
- Grand Coteau, La has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Lusaka Int. has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- Grand Coteau, La is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Lusaka Int. is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 0.1 °C (0.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.8 °C (15.8°F) more in Grand Coteau, La.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 656.6 mm (25.9 in) more which is equivalent to 656.6 l/m² (16.11 US gal/ft²) or 6,566,000 l/ha (701,949 US gal/ac) more. About 1 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.8° lower in Grand Coteau, La than in Lusaka Int..
